Hey Primoz, if you go to the Park Tool video I linked to, at 3:07 you can see their spoke tension map that shows the top and bottom spokes both losing tension as they sit on the bike. It's the spokes on the sides that gain tension, because the rim is flexing in at the bottom from rider weight and compression and pushing those forces out to the left and the right, like my coffee cup example above.
